Lima

Peru's coastal capital, where ocean views, buzzing neighbourhoods, and world-class dining make it one of South America's most exciting food cities.

Signature Grapes of Lima

Signature Foods

  • Ceviche and tiradito
  • Nikkei cuisine (Japanese-Peruvian)
  • Anticuchos and street-food favourites
  • Churros, picarones, and sweet treats

Best Time to Visit

December–April

Warmer, sunnier days and clearer skies

May–November

Cooler weather and a cosy, city-focused vibe
